Career path
- Logistics Manager: Oversees the movement and storage of goods, products, and resources, ensuring timely and cost-effective delivery. (Salary range: £40,000 - £70,000)
- Supply Chain Manager: Develops and implements strategies to optimize the flow of goods, services, and information from raw materials to end customers. (Salary range: £50,000 - £80,000)
- Transportation Manager: Coordinates and manages the movement of goods, products, and resources through various modes of transportation, such as road, rail, air, and sea. (Salary range: £45,000 - £75,000)
- Operations Manager: Oversees the day-to-day activities of a logistics or transportation company, ensuring efficient and effective operations. (Salary range: £35,000 - £60,000)
- Procurement Manager: Sourcing and purchasing goods, services, and resources to meet the needs of a logistics or transportation company. (Salary range: £30,000 - £55,000)
- Inventory Manager: Responsible for managing and controlling inventory levels, ensuring accurate and timely delivery of goods and products. (Salary range: £25,000 - £45,000)
